ChongTongPetPet SuppliesNo serious buyer should place a bulk order on photos alone. Here is exactly how sampling works with us — what it costs, how long it takes, and how the sample fee comes back to you on your first order.
Which one you need decides the cost and the wait. Most buyers start with a stock sample to judge our build quality, then move to a custom sample once the design is locked.
An existing catalog product, or one lightly adjusted (your color, your label). Best for judging our materials, stitching, and finish before you invest in development.
Your design, your materials, your packaging — the exact article that bulk will be judged against. Approving this sample locks the standard for your whole order.
Five clear steps from your first message to an approved sample you can hold in your hands.
Share product, materials, size, color, and label. We confirm feasibility and MOQ.
You get a sample fee, courier estimate, and lead time. Approve and pay to start.
Our sample room builds it and sends photos before shipping for your sign-off.
Courier by DHL / FedEx / UPS with a tracking number, usually 3–7 days in transit.
Test it, approve it, and we hold it as the golden sample for your bulk run.
